Rear axle fluid level
Check the oil level of the rear axle every 250 hours.
1.
Place the machine on a firm level surface and shut
down the engine.
2.
Slowly remove the oil check/fill plug. Oil should be
even with the plug orifice.
3.
Add oil as needed.
4.
Install the plug.

Rear axle breather
Clean the rear axle breather every 250 hours of operation. If you operate the machine in severe conditions, clean it
more frequently.
1.
Remove dirt and debris from the area around the
breather and clean with solvent.
NOTE:
Image is from the rear of the machine looking to-
wards the front of the machine.
2.
CAUTION
Eye injury hazard!
Wear protective goggles when using
compressed air.
Failure to comply could result in minor or
moderate injury.
C0035A
Blow dry the area with compressed air.
3.
Spin the top cap to ensue that it is free to turn.
